Visitors will enjoy an intimate, hour-long reading by a poet in one of the Gardner Museum‘s historic galleries this weekend.

Major Jackson is the author of four collections of poetry: Roll Deep (W. W. Norton, 2015), Holding Company (2010) and Hoops ( 2006), both finalists for an NAACP Image Award for Outstanding Literature-Poetry, and Leaving Saturn (University of Georgia, 2002), winner of the 2001 Cave Canem Poetry Prize and finalist for a National Book Critics Award Circle.

Gallery Pop-Up: Poets in the Palace presents Major Jackson on Dec. 11, from 3-4 PM. Visitors are welcome to experience the poetry reading as they move through the galleries. The reading is free with museum admission and no registration is required.
